Java AndroidManifest.xml中的元数据标记没有正确的值

Java AndroidManifest.xml中的元数据标记没有正确的值,java,android,google-play-services,Java,Android,Google Play Services,我的问题是,我用我的应用程序设置了一个旧版本的google play服务,用于广告,一切都很好,这个版本的应用程序目前正在google play上生产。自从新版本的google play services问世以来,我没有更新过任何代码。当我尝试更新某些内容时,在具有最新版本的google play services的设备上进行测试时,会出现以下错误: java.lang.IllegalStateException: The meta-data tag in your app's AndroidM

我的问题是,我用我的应用程序设置了一个旧版本的google play服务,用于广告,一切都很好,这个版本的应用程序目前正在google play上生产。自从新版本的google play services问世以来,我没有更新过任何代码。当我尝试更新某些内容时,在具有最新版本的google play services的设备上进行测试时,会出现以下错误:

java.lang.IllegalStateException: The meta-data tag in your app's AndroidManifest.xml does not have the right value.  Expected 4132500 but found 4242000.  You must have the following declaration within the <application> element:     <meta-data android:name="com.google.android.gms.version" android:value="@integer/google_play_services_version" />
    at com.google.android.gms.common.GooglePlayServicesUtil.n(Unknown Source)
    at com.google.android.gms.common.GooglePlayServicesUtil.isGooglePlayServicesAvailable(Unknown Source)
    at com.google.android.gms.internal.u.a(Unknown Source)
    at com.google.android.gms.internal.ag.U(Unknown Source)
    at com.google.android.gms.internal.ag.a(Unknown Source)
java.lang.IllegalStateException:应用程序的AndroidManifest.xml中的元数据标记没有正确的值。预计为4132500,但发现为4242000。元素中必须有以下声明:
位于com.google.android.gms.common.GooglePlayServicesUtil.n(未知来源)
位于com.google.android.gms.common.GooglePlayServicesUtil.isgoogleplayservicesavaailable(未知来源)
在com.google.android.gms.internal.u.a(未知来源)
在com.google.android.gms.internal.ag.U(未知来源)
位于com.google.android.gms.internal.ag.a(未知来源)
这就是我的AndroidManifest的样子:

....
<application
        <meta-data android:name="com.google.android.gms.version"
                   android:value="@integer/google_play_services_version" />
    </application>
....
。。。。

您链接了一个错误的版本google-play-services.jar。 您应该使用android sdk/extras/google/google\u play\u services/libproject/google-play-services\u lib/libs/google play services.jar中的jar


使用android sdk/extras/google/google\u play\u services/libproject/google-play-services\u lib/res/values/version.xml中的版本号,我刚刚遇到了这个错误。我刚刚在中将2行移到configChange行上方的底部,现在它又可以工作了。没有其他变化